HC Deb 03 December 1941 vol 376 cc1106-7
3. Mr. Rhys Davies

asked the Secretary of State for Foreign Affairs whether the British Council in their contacts with the British community in the Argentine have got in touch with the Welsh settlement in Patagonia?

Mr. Law

No, Sir. The British Council has not so far had occasion to establish contact with this community, but the pos sibilities will be examined.

Mr. Davies

Will the hon. Gentleman suggest to the British Council that they arrange that films depicting life in this country and especially in Wales be shown to the Welsh community in Patagonia?

Mr. Law

I will certainly take up that matter.
